Web13 de dez. de 2024 · First, we relatively translate the 3D mesh (voxel assembly) by half the voxel unit. This is explained by the fact that when we created our initial voxel grid, the reference was the lowest left point of the voxel instead of the barycenter (which is positioned at [0.5,0.5,0.5] relatively in the unit cube).
